Fields of Wheat near Hastings: An Ode to Nature
"Fields of Wheat near Hastings" by John Horace Hooper is a vibrant depiction of the English countryside. This canvas, where golden fields stretch as far as the eye can see, evokes the richness and beauty of rural landscapes. The shades of yellow and green, subtly blended, create an atmosphere of tranquility and fullness. The delicate and precise brushstrokes pay homage to natural light, while the light blue sky adds a sense of depth to the scene. The artwork invites contemplation and appreciation of the wonders of nature.
John Horace Hooper: an artist of the Pre-Raphaelite movement
John Horace Hooper, active in the 19th century, is often associated with the Pre-Raphaelite movement, which advocated a return to nature and craftsmanship. Influenced by his contemporaries, he developed a distinctive style that highlights the beauty of landscapes and rural life. "Fields of Wheat near Hastings" perfectly illustrates this approach, demonstrating his commitment to faithful representation of nature. Hooper captured the essence of his era, marked by a fascination with the natural world and a desire to move away from academic conventions.
